Transaction fb330ab7d33ad6f731807ebca169982a86944ab380cb985c16d290feaba9cb71
1 Input
1 Output
-
fb330ab7d33ad6f731807ebca169982a86944ab380cb985c16d290feaba9cb71:0
- value
- 686648629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 278cb31206409dc367a1a82b7391e2873053c7be OP_EQUAL
- address
- MBWH8tDK2PDbT9dJuC5DVtXGrnxCsCgA9F